Concerning the decals. One has to put the decal names in the downloads.txt file of Mani configuration. This makes the decals be downloaded automatically when a user connects to the server. Otherwise the decals should be installed manually.

I have added the decals used in hangar in the hangar map file, but that involved that the size of the map file was 500 ko greater. So, if we put the decals in the map file, the file would be greater and if one of the decal are used in more than one map, that involves that the decal would be downloaded at least two times...

So, if you prefer maps of little size, the solution is to include the one steambob propose to us. And I think it is the best one, because each decal would be downloaded only once.

If I'm right (but I'm still a noob to mapping, now I think I have the bases, nothing more), we can add everything (model, texture, decal's, ...) in the bsp with the bspzip method. I used this program to add two little custom decals to one of the map. But I don't want to use this method for the decal's we use on more than one map. For each texture we add, the bsp is increased by about 300 ko.
